The Mechanics of Reviving a Trusty USB Stick

So, what makes a USB stick tick, and how can we breathe new life into one that’s lost its spark? The answer lies in the simple, yet often overlooked, mechanics of data storage.

Every USB stick uses a type of flash memory to store data, which is essentially a series of interconnected transistors that retain electrical charge even when power is turned off. This makes it possible to store and retrieve data at incredibly high speeds, making USB sticks an ideal solution for transferring files and backing up important data.

However, this also means that USB sticks are prone to wear and tear, particularly when it comes to the delicate transistor connections. When a USB stick starts to malfunction, it’s often a sign that these connections have become worn or damaged, preventing the stick from functioning properly.

Why USB Sticks Fail, and What You Can Do About It

So, why do USB sticks fail in the first place, and what are the warning signs to look out for? The answer lies in understanding the common causes of failure, from physical damage to software glitches.

Physical damage is one of the most common causes of USB stick failure. This can be anything from a broken plug to a cracked casing, which can compromise the delicate transistor connections and make it impossible to retrieve data.

Software glitches are another common cause of failure, often resulting from outdated firmware or corrupted file systems. When this happens, the USB stick may become unreadable, or even freeze up altogether.

How to Recover Data from a Dead USB Stick

So, what happens when your trusty USB stick finally gives up the ghost? Don’t panic – there’s still hope for recovering your precious data, even if the stick itself is beyond repair.

The key is to act quickly, as the sooner you attempt to recover data, the better your chances of success. Start by using specialized software designed specifically for USB stick recovery, which can scan the device for remaining data and copy it safely to your computer.

If the software fails to recover any data, it may be worth trying a manual recovery method, such as using a data retrieval service or taking the stick to a professional data recovery expert.

8 Simple Steps to Breathe New Life Into Your Trusty USB Stick

So, what can you do to breathe new life into your trusty USB stick? Follow these 8 simple steps:

  • Check for physical damage and replace the stick if necessary.
  • Update the firmware to ensure you have the latest version.
  • Run a virus scan to rule out any malware that may be causing problems.
  • Try formatting the stick to see if it resolves any issues.
  • Use specialized software to recover any remaining data.
  • Take the stick to a professional data recovery expert if necessary.
  • Replace the stick with a new one, backing up any important data first.
  • Consider upgrading to a more advanced storage solution, such as an external hard drive.
